Photograph Information Photographer's Comments
Challenge: Blue (Classic Editing)
Camera: Nikon D1X
Location: portland,MI
Date: Nov 30, 2002
Aperture: f-11
ISO: 800 ISO
Shutter: 30 full seconds
Date Uploaded: Nov 30, 2002

daughter in hot tub. 30 full second exposure. no minip and no crop. off camera fill flash only, from the side. and the blue hot tub light from under the water

Critique Club critique:

Let me improve upon my previous comments:

COMPOSITION/CONTENT: Very interesting and unique blue glow over the hot tub. The two lights on the right side of the piture are what my eyes see first, since they are a contrasting color and are in a dark background. With cropping them out, this photograph becomes an excellent work and completely different. With cropping, the blue glow becomes a halo, with the center of the halo over Jennifer's head, making the blue and Jennifer the focal point of the picture rather than the lights on the right. With cropping this picture gets an 8 or 9 from me.
BACKGROUND: would benefit greatly with the right side cropped.
CAMERA WORK/TECHNICAL: unique and creative use of exposure to create the blue glow over the hot tub.
DIGITAL PROCESSING/TECHNICAL: does not need post processing other than crop.
MY OPINION: By looking at this photograph a second time, I have learned to look closer at the photographs that I am commenting on and that making comments on a first glance doesn't do anybody justice. You have a very creative and excellent photo that would have scored much higher with one little tweak. Great job!
